Zac Tassone joined Head Coach Casey Huckel’s coaching staff at Chestnut Hill College as an assistant prior to the 2014 season. A four-year starter at West Chester University and an experienced coach at both the club and collegiate levels, Tassone brings a strong foundation of knowledge to the Griffins men’s soccer program.

Before coming to Chestnut Hill College, Tassone spent two years as an assistant with the Immaculata College men’s soccer program, who he helped guide to the Colonial States Athletic Conference (CSAC) playoffs. He also served as a Senior Technical Staff Member and a Residential Camp Director at Total Soccer Academy (2008-2013), who provides small group and private lessons to players ranging from preschoolers to aspiring professionals.

In addition to working at Chestnut Hill College, Tassone coaches within the Continental Football Club (FC) Delco US Soccer Development Academy (USSDA) and Pre-Academy programs and acts as a Senior Technical Staff Member at 360 Soccer Academy. He holds a National Soccer Coaches Association of America (NSCAA) Advanced Regional diploma as well as a United States Soccer Federation (USSF) “D” License, and is currently pursuing his “C” License.

As a student-athlete, Tassone scripted a standout career at West Chester University, where he was a four-year starter at center midfield and forward. Tassone served as team captain for the Golden Rams during his senior season. He finished his collegiate career with 12 goals and 4 assists before participating in several professional combines and team trials. Tassone recently spent time on the roster of Football Club (FC) Reading Revolution of the National Premier Soccer League (NPSL).

Tassone is committed to educating both on and off the field. In addition to his coaching credentials, Tassone also works as a physical education teacher and Middle School Athletic Director at New Foundations Charter School in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. Tassone graduated from West Chester University in 2011 with a degree in health and physical education. He currently resides in the Roxborough area of Philadelphia.
